History
  • The early 2000s marked a distinctive era in fashion characterized by bold colors and graphic designs, influenced by streetwear and skate culture.
  • Point Zero is recognized within the industry for its contributions to youth and casual fashion, particularly during the turn of the millennium.
  • Vintage pieces from this decade often signify a nostalgic trend, appealing to individuals seeking to capture the essence of early 2000s style.
Design Significance
  • The striped pattern can be seen as a classic design element, often associated with laid-back casualwear and skater culture from the 2000s.
  • Long sleeve shirts featuring panel stripes across the chest emerged as popular choices, reflecting a sense of individuality and casual comfort from that period.
  • The use of cotton fabric is indicative of a commitment to comfort and breathability, which was a prevalent preference in casual wear during the early 2000s.
